Connect your router to computer with ethernet cable.
Then you can access it with following link.
http://192.168.1.1
or
http://192.168.0.1
type user as "admin" and password as "admin" or blank or "password"
Then
you can see configuration page of router.Click on wireless and If you
want secure router then enable WEP security then add new code it is
your password key for connect wi fi.

You will need to first hook a computer directly up to the router using a LAN cable. Then using your internet browser type in the address of 192.168.0.1 or 192.168.1.1 and screen should appear asking for a user name and password. If a password and user name was never created then the default user name is blank(no entry) and pasword is "admin". This will get you into the router settings menu where you can find and make changes to the WEP or WPA key. If that user name and password does not work then you will need to use the reset button on the router(it is a hole and you will need to use a pen to push it). This will reset the pasword to the default one.
